Я создаю список, который затем использую для создания фрейма данных pandas, а затем добавляю его к другому фрейму данных pandas той же длины.Код работает нормально, но ужасно неэффективно:
experiment_list = []
number_of_runs = list(range(0, 10000))
for i in range(len(df)):
if i == len(df):
break
for j in range(len(number_of_runs)):
experiment_list.append(i)
Я думаю, что существует вложенный цикл for и очень длинный список создает неэффективность.
Я использую Python 3.
Есть ли способ повысить эффективность этого кода?
Приветствия.